Portfolio scope
Commercial programmes differ from utility farms in interface density: multiple roofs, varied structural ages, tenant arrangements and shift patterns that dictate when crews may work. Solar Powerstations Victoria treats each host as an operating facility first and a generation site second. Representative work includes the Latrobe Industrial Rooftop Portfolio (4.8 MW across three plants) and Geelong Port Logistics Solar (2.1 MW carport and rooftop in a marine environment).
We aggregate portfolios for institutional owners seeking consistent engineering standards, unified O&M reporting and consolidated warranty management. Single-site hosts receive the same quality framework scaled to their risk profile.
Structural and electrical engineering
Every installation begins with structural assessment against Australian standards and insurer expectations. We document load paths, penetration details, ballast or fixings, and wind regions before panels arrive. Electrical design addresses export limits, power factor, harmonics and selective coordination with existing switchboards. Where batteries are added, protection and earthing are integrated holistically rather than bolted on as an afterthought.
- Rooftop, carport and ground-mount layouts
- Thermal imaging and string design optimisation
- Export control and DNSP application where required
- Integration with existing HV or LV infrastructure
Construction under live operations
Staging plans align with production peaks, crane windows and site safety officers. Fall-arrest, exclusion zones and permit-to-work systems are non-negotiable. We coordinate deliveries to avoid blocking freight corridors — particularly at ports and distribution centres where 24/7 movement is contractual.
Metering, PPAs and abatement reporting
Export metering is reconciled with retailer contracts and behind-the-meter allocation models. We support hosts evaluating physical PPAs, synthetic structures or capex ownership with honest comparison of risk allocation. Abatement and savings reports are formatted for sustainability disclosures without overstating avoided emissions.

Safety, compliance and handover
Handover packs include as-built drawings, test certificates, inverter warranties and emergency isolation procedures posted for site personnel. We train maintenance staff on lockout and basic fault response before demobilisation. Defects liability periods are tracked with the same rigour as utility programmes.
Operations and lifecycle
Commercial assets benefit from preventive maintenance, inverter monitoring and thermal spot checks. Our O&M team can operate under unified SLAs across multi-site portfolios. Upgrade pathways — capacity increases or battery add-ons — are planned with spare conduit and switchboard capacity where feasible.
Portfolio approach for multi-site hosts
Manufacturing groups with several Victorian facilities benefit from standardised designs, unified O&M contracts and consolidated reporting. We sequence works to match capital allowances and production calendars rather than treating each roof as an isolated race to lowest $/W.
Export and self-consumption strategies are tested against actual load shapes and DNSP settings—not generic templates—before financial close on portfolio programmes.

Frequently asked questions
What roof types can you assess?
Metal deck, concrete, membrane and composite systems—with structural engineer sign-off before module load is approved.
Can you deliver multi-site portfolios?
Yes. Standardised design, unified O&M and consolidated reporting across Victorian facilities.
How is tenant solar allocation handled?
Sub-metering and reporting formats are agreed before financial close where green leases require attribution.
